Chapter 345: Disappointing

Chu Lingxuan, noticing Chen Feng’s insincere expression, gently pinched her nose and remarked, “You already know my intentions, why ask such questions?” With that, he lay down, running his hand through her dark hair.

Chen Feng chuckled, “Resting so early isn’t General Chu’s style.”

Chu Lingxuan smiled and pulled her into his arms, whispering softly.

With her face nestled against his neck, inhaling his pleasant scent and listening to his murmurs, Chen Feng felt her eyelids growing heavier.

“…I’m busy every day outside, rarely spending time with you and the family. You have to care for your grandfather, raise your daughter, and look after two royal bloodlines… You’ve worked hard. In a few days, I’ll have to…”

Hearing the soft, drowsy sound near his neck, Chu Lingxuan looked down to find Chen Feng already asleep. Chuckling, he held her until late into the night before drifting off himself.

When Chen Feng woke up, it was already dawn, and she could still sense his lingering scent on the pillow, but he was already gone.

Autumn mentioned, “The Master left at the hour of the Tiger (around 3-5:00 AM), he didn’t want us to disturb you.”

Dabao arrived, curious to know if his father had slept with his mother last night. Despite almost asking, he refrained, fearing it might upset his mother.

Breakfast was served with an array of delicate snacks and congee, but Chen Feng had no appetite.

Upon Mama Li’s urging, she managed to eat an egg, a small bowl of rice porridge, but skipped the pan-fried bun.

Mama Li panicked, “Madam, how can you starve the baby like this?”

Chen Feng reassured, “The baby won’t starve. I’m waiting for the sour and spicy rice noodles that Chu Huai bought.”

At the mention of the rice noodles, her mouth watered again, and she quickly swallowed.

Seeing off Dabao, she waited until the time of the Snake (around 9-11:00 AM), when Chu Huai finally returned with the sour and spicy rice noodles. The shop owner had pre-prepared the broth to prevent the noodles from sticking during the journey to the countryside, providing Chu Huai with fresh noodles for cooking.

Seeing Chu Huai drenched in sweat, Chen Feng felt guilty. Her craving had led him on a long journey back and forth, totaling over two hundred miles. She rewarded him with five taels of silver and insisted he rest.

To avoid spilling, the broth was stored in a large teapot. Mama Hua heated the broth in the small kitchen, cooked the noodles separately, then combined them in the soup, ready to be served in Yanxiang Pavilion.

The aroma tantalized Chen Feng’s taste buds. Despite the slightly softened soybeans and peanuts, the flavor was still exquisite. She instructed to inform Chu Huai that whenever the Master returned to Tangyuan, he should bring a bowl of noodles.

Mama Li, frowning, advised, “Madam, you shouldn’t eat too much of this. It’s not good for the baby’s skin.”

Chen Feng thought to herself that the baby was only the size of a fingernail, so skin development wasn’t a concern yet. She replied, “I only eat when my appetite is poor. When it improves, I’ll stop.”

After the meal, Chu Hanyan and Little Xuan joined them in the main room, and they headed to Fengyuan for their “lessons.” Wang Xiaodi and Wang Xiaomei were already waiting at the gate.

Despite repeated insistence from the old Marquis and Mrs. Wang, Chen Feng temporarily relinquished her teaching duties starting that day. Autumn took over as a preschool teacher, engaging the children in activities like playing with blocks, storytelling, and “martial arts practice” in the children’s playground in the backyard. To ensure the children’s happiness and to prevent them from overwhelming Chen Feng, they would now have their rest in the west wing of Fengyuan after lunch, return to Tangyuan after their afternoon classes.

Having shadowed Chen Feng for so long, Autumn had acquired most of the teaching skills and could handle the role competently.

Chen Feng sat in the corridor sewing clothes for the children, with Mrs. Wang and Mrs. Wu accompanying her, also sewing.

At this moment, Fengyuan was at its most beautiful, with a riot of colors and blooming flowers, exuding a fragrant aroma throughout the garden. In contrast, Tangyuan, while beautiful, appeared somewhat monotonous.

Watching the children and the pets practice martial arts, Mrs. Wu laughed heartily. This sight never failed to bring her joy. With a good life and a contented heart, Mrs. Wu’s health had improved significantly, and she had gained some weight.

As noon approached, the servants arrived to announce the arrival of the lady of the house.

Perplexed, Chen Feng said, “My mother is already here.”

The servant chuckled and clarified, “It’s the lady from the capital.”

It turned out to be Madam Jiang.

Chen Feng quickly stood up and said to Mrs. Wang, “Mother, I’ll go.”

Mrs. Wang nodded and said, “Go ahead. Mrs. Jiang has come a long way to support you, and it’s not easy for her.”

Chen Feng agreed, seeing the children happily playing, she let them be and, accompanied by Mama Li and Xiaomo, headed back to Tangyuan.

In Yanxiang Pavilion, Madam Jiang sat with Chen Yuqing and Chen Yuxia.

Upon entering, Chen Feng first paid respects to Madam Jiang, then chatted with the Chen sisters.

However, Chen Feng noticed the slight redness around Madam Jiang’s eyes and her tired complexion. It was clear she hadn’t rested well, having made the journey to see her. Chen Feng appreciated her efforts.

She suggested, “Mother and sisters, stay a few more days here. The countryside scenery is quite different. We women can stroll around the estate anytime, unlike in the city where stepping out requires preparation.”

Madam Jiang agreed, “Perhaps later. This morning, your father left for business out of town. With the elderly lady at home and that troublesome fellow…” She paused, then waved her hand, saying, “Ah, once she’s married off, things will settle at home.”

Not delving further, Chen Feng understood she referred to Chen Yuhui. She wondered what trouble the girl had caused to upset Madam Jiang.

After discussing some matters with Chen Feng and offering pregnancy advice, Madam Jiang instructed to bring out the gifts brought from home, including ginseng and bird’s nest. Additionally, there was a gift to be sent to Luyuan, which Chen Feng arranged to have delivered.

Due to Madam Jiang’s visit, they didn’t dine in Hai Tang Hall as usual but had a meal set up in the west wing.

After the meal, Chen Dabao, Chu Hanyan, and Luu came to Yanxiang Pavilion to pay respects to Madam Jiang. It was the first time Madam Jiang had met Dabao and Lu, she chatted with them, exchanged pleasantries, and gave them gifts.

While Madam Jiang was engaged with the children, Chen Yuqing leaned in and whispered to Chen Feng, “Chen Yuhui is really disappointing. She even thinks of such shameless things. Grandmother has to support her, and Mother is furious. Father just said he’s busy with work and left, leaving the mess for Mother to handle, asking her to look after them. Mother was so upset she nearly fell ill…”

As she spoke, Chen Yuqing’s eyes welled up with tears.

Observing Madam Jiang looking worn out, Chen Feng reflected on her appearance. Despite her adornments and makeup, she appeared much older than her actual age, her features plain.
